5. PARTICIPATING ON THE AIDS CANDLELIGHT MEMORIAL SERVICE 2007
Organised by the Action For AIDS (AFA), this is an annual international event held to remember those who have died from AIDS. The Memorial provides an opportunity to come to terms with death and AIDS. It has become a powerful symbol of the presence of AIDS in Singapore, and a timely reminder for the community & Singaporeans at large to renew its commitment to fight AIDS discrimination.
